What is 6592 in binary? Below we show you the result of the decimal to binary conversion straightaway 🙂
Decimal 6592 = 1100111000000 Binary
Any integer can be written as sum of potencies to the power of 2, known as binary code.
Here’s the proof that 1100111000000 is the correct result:
1×2^12 + 1×2^11 + 0x2^10 + 0x2^9 + 1×2^8 + 1×2^7 + 1×2^6 + 0x2^5 + 0x2^4 + 0x2^3 + 0x2^2 + 0x2^1 + 0x2^0 = 6592
